Should You Start or Sit Matthew Golden in Week 6?
We get spoiled from rookie receivers that burst onto the scene right away. There are a select few that enter the NFL as polished prospects, and those are the ones we remember, but the vast majority of players take time to develop.
Matthew Golden has reached double-digit PPR points in consecutive games and has seen his expected point total increase during each of his first four career games.
He’s not going to be rookie season Brian Thomas Jr., but that doesn’t mean he can’t be an impactful piece as the weather begins to turn. Golden has seen a target with over 25 air yards attached to it in three straight, and while the target distribution in Green Bay is annoying, it also limits the amount of attention that can be paid to any one player.
If you’re chasing points after Thursday night or even after the first wave of games on Sunday, plugging in a profile like that of Golden is a reasonable play.
The range of outcomes is going to be wide weekly, but the upside is worthy of your attention when in advantageous spots like this.
